Transaction 71caf7869c11ea9ed147c68155fd323f87e7e4d4e1994d98aaec59a817dfbc0d

1 Input
2 Outputs
  • 71caf7869c11ea9ed147c68155fd323f87e7e4d4e1994d98aaec59a817dfbc0d:0
  • value  1800000000
    address  1HSHuCG8Ku5RD4EQqr96GJpZtCcoHUiT7j
  • 71caf7869c11ea9ed147c68155fd323f87e7e4d4e1994d98aaec59a817dfbc0d:1
  • value  28199984180
    address  1NmwAhuVuW97JfkbwGBmbDSeavDKP7tqd9